Mascot Job Summary
Job Summary:
As a Mascot, you will be responsible for bringing to life the character and spirit of our organization or team by portraying our beloved Mascot. Your role is vital in creating a memorable and entertaining experience for fans, engaging with audiences of all ages, and enhancing the overall fan engagement at events, games, and promotional activities.
Mascot Duties and Responsibilities
Assume the persona of the Mascot character and convey emotions, energy, and enthusiasm through exaggerated movements, gestures, and body language.
Perform dance routines, stunts, and crowd interactions to entertain and engage fans during games and events.
Encourage audience participation, including leading cheers and chants, and posing for photos with fans.
Assist in marketing campaigns and merchandise sales through Mascot-related promotions.
Maintain the Mascot costume, ensuring it remains in good condition and is clean and safe for each performance.
Be punctual and prepared for all performances.
Mascot Requirements and Qualifications
Excellent physical stamina and endurance to perform in a Mascot costume for extended periods, often in varying weather conditions.
Strong non-verbal communication skills, including the ability to convey emotions and enthusiasm through physical gestures and expressions.
A friendly and engaging personality, with the ability to interact positively with fans and represent the organization professionally.
Comfortable performing in a confined costume with limited visibility and mobility, adapting to different performance environments and situations.
Prioritize safety, following safety protocols, and ensuring the well-being of both the performer and fans.
Flexibility in work hours, including evenings, weekends, and holidays, to accommodate the organization's event schedule.
